EuMAS - European Masters course in Aeronautics and Space Technology - (option Space Technology)

Course Details

Objectives : EuMAS is a two-year programme jointly offered by 5 European aerospace schools.
EuMAS provides world-class education in aerospace engineering field, preparing the students to start a successful professional activity as an Aerospace Engineer;
Successful students are awarded a double degree in Aerospace Engineeering by the two partners univesities (among the 5) in charge of the Master.
EuMAS is one of the masters courses selected by the European Commission Eurasmus Mundus.p

Concerned public : Students European or non-European

Prerequisites : Application is open to students who have completed at least three years of undergraduate education in an engineering discipline or in an applied science

Admission requirements : At least three years of undergraduate education in an engineering education or in an applied Science. Extensisve undergraduate preparation in physics, chemistry, thermodynamics, mechanics, engineering and mathematics is required

Duration and terms : 2 years

Notes : - This multi-national training is coordinated by the Universita of Pisa: Dipartimento di Ingegneria Aerospaziale, Via Girolamo Caruso 8, 56122 Pisa, Italia - web: http://www.spaceatdia.org
- The third cycle of EuMAS starting in September 2010 will be hosted at Pisa (first Year, 2010/2011) and Toulouse(second Year, 2011/2012).

- From students from non-English-speaking contries , a satisfactory completion of the TOEFL or IELTS or equivalent certification is required.

International partnerships : This Master is also offered by Universita di Pisa and Cranfield University
